## Changelog — Ticktrace 1.9

### Renamed: DRIFT_API_TOKEN
During the cron drift investigation we found plugins confusing this variable with the metrics token, so it has been renamed to indicate it authorizes drift-report uploads specifically. Plugin authors must read the new name from 1.9 onward; the old name is ignored without warning. Sample env files in the SDK are updated. In your deployment env file, the drift-report upload secret is set on the next line.

env line for fawef-taguf: VAULT_KEY13=a9695905a9a90

Re: Retirement of the Stonebriar product line

Stonebriar sales have declined for five consecutive quarters and support costs now exceed contribution margin. The retirement plan is staged: new orders close end of Q2, existing contracts honoured through their terms, and spares stocked for twenty-four months. Sales leads should steer prospects toward the Ashgrove range; migration incentives are already approved. Customer comms are drafted and awaiting legal sign-off. The forward strategy behind this decision is set out in the note below.

confidential, yafog-hagug: Gross margin on Druix came in at 10 percent against a plan of 15 percent. Only 5 of the 80 pilot accounts renewed Druix, so a churn review is set for October 1.

## Tuning

GateCount's debounce window controls how fast consecutive turnstile pulses at Harwick Field register as distinct entries. Too low and vibration double-counts; too high and rush-hour crowds undercount. We validated against manual tallies from the Kestrel Stand last season. Adjust only after a full match-day replay. Current constants for the weekly sync are listed below.

constants for tageg-kagag:
QUOTAS = {
    "kelax": 495,
    "istath": 366,
    "tammir": 108,
    "novdor": 730,
    "casax": 816,
    "quenael": 874,
    "pelius": 403,
}

## Local Setup — FareTrial Pricing Experiment

Hey on-call — if FareTrial pages you, you'll probably want to run it locally. Clone the repo, install deps with `make bootstrap`, and copy `env.sample` to `.env`. The experiment service needs the price-bucket tables seeded; run `make seed` once. Feature flags come from the Loomis flag server, but there's a stub mode if it's down (`STUB_FLAGS=1`). Point your local instance at the shared experiment database using the connection string below.

replica DSN, yahaf-yagaf: mongodb://tamath_svc:a2netSk3RZMuTj@db-d084.novacsoft.internal:5432/ralmir